What is legal insurance and why is it so important?

Legal insurance is a type of coverage that can help reduce the potential financial burden when you find yourself in a legal dispute. It can protect you from the high costs of legal representation and the high fees that lawyers can charge for services. What Does a Legal Insurance Quote Include?

A legal insurance quote will give you an estimate of how much the policy will cost, how much coverage you will receive, how long the policy will last, and any additional information you need to know about the policy. The information provided in the quote will vary depending on the type of policy you select, but you will be able to get information about the amount of coverage, length of coverage, and deductible. You will also be able to choose your payment method, which may include a lump sum payment, a set premium payment each month, or a combination of the two. How to Buy Legal Insurance From a Company

To get a legal insurance quote from a company, you will want to visit the company’s website, call the customer service number on the website, or contact the company directly. You will first need to complete an application, either online or over the phone, depending on the company. Once you submit your application, the company will review it and get back to you with a quote. The company may also provide you with information about how to purchase the coverage.
